PURPOSE:
The City of Greensboro received funding in the amount of $465,522 from the Federal Transit Administration (FTA) for the purchase of eight (8) less than 30 foot replacement paratransit vehicles. The North Carolina Department of Transportation recently approved a state match funding request in the amount of $38,337 to support eligible expenses. A resolution must be approved to accept these funds.

BACKGROUND:
At the April 24, 2018 meeting, the Greensboro City Council approved a budget ordinance establishing FY2017 FTA Section 5339 Bus and Bus Facilities Grant funding in the amount of $465,522. These funds will be used to replace eight (8) less than 30 foot paratransit vehicles that have exceeded FTA's useful life standards, both in years of service and mileage. The useful life standards are 5 years or 200,000 miles for a paratransit bus.

The purchase and delivery of the eight (8) paratransit vehicles will take place during fiscal year 2019 and amount to a total cost of $547,673. The North Carolina Department of Transportation has approved a state funding match request in the amount of $38,337 (7%) for this purchase. This will reduce the City's local match to $43,814 (8%). Previously, the 15% required local match was coming entirely out of GTA's local transit fund.

BUDGET IMPACT:
The North Carolina Department of Transportation will contribute $38,337 towards the purchase of the eight (8) replacement paratransit buses during fiscal year 2019, thereby lowering the City's local match amount.

The original funding was as follows:
$465,522 (85%) Federal
$82,151 (15%) Local
